MUHAMMAD SARWAR Versus STATE
ORDER
The learned counsel for the petitioner states at the outset that in view of notice issued to Sarwar for enhancement of punishment awarded to him, h, would not press the petition to his extent. This application to the extent of Muhammad Sarwar is, therefore, dismissed as not pressed.
2. So far as Muhammad Munawar petitioner is concerned he was burdened only with a blunt weapon injury on the head of the deceased. This is a lacerated wound 1.5 c.m. x..5 c.m, x skin deep and it is argued by the learned counsel for the petitioner that this could not be the result of a hatchet blow even though given from the wrong side.
3. Be that as it may, the fact remains that the petitioner has been in custody for more than two years and the appeal filed by him has still not been decided.
4. In this view of the matter; the sentences awarded to Muhammad Munawar, petitioner, are suspended and he is directed to be released on bail subject to his furnishing security in the sum of Rs.50,000 with two sureties each in the like amount to the satisfaction of the learned trial Court.
